What You'll Learn

Preheat the air fryer to 380°F (193°C) for 3-5 minutes
Preheating your air fryer is an important step in the cooking process. It ensures that your food cooks evenly and that the timing is accurate. For Ellio's Pizza, preheat your air fryer to 380°F (193°C) for 3-5 minutes. This temperature is higher than the recommended temperature for frozen foods, which is usually around 375°F (190°C). However, the higher temperature will help create a crispy crust, a desirable trait in Ellio's Pizza.
While the air fryer is preheating, you can prepare your pizza slices. Take out the Ellio's Pizza from the freezer and remove the desired number of slices from the packaging. If you want to add extra toppings, this is the time to do so. Place your chosen toppings on top of the slices.
Once the air fryer has preheated, it's time to arrange the pizza slices in the air fryer basket. Place them in a single layer, ensuring they don't overlap, as this will affect even cooking.
After preheating and arranging the slices, the actual cooking process of the pizza begins. This will take 5-7 minutes, depending on how crispy you like your pizza. Check the pizza after 5 minutes to see if it's cooked to your liking. The cheese should be melted and bubbly, and the crust should be golden brown.
Once the pizza is cooked to your preference, carefully remove the slices from the air fryer using tongs or a spatula. Serve immediately and enjoy the delicious, crispy Ellio's Pizza!

Prepare the pizza slices and add toppings
Preparing Ellio's pizza slices in an air fryer is a straightforward process that delivers a tasty, quick, and easy meal. The first step is to preheat your air fryer to the recommended temperature for frozen foods, typically around 375°F (190°C) or 380°F (193°C).
Once preheated, it's time to prepare the pizza slices. Take the desired number of Ellio's pizza slices from the freezer and remove them from the packaging. If you wish to add extra toppings, now is the time to place them on top of the slices. You can experiment with various toppings to enhance the flavour and texture of your pizza. Here are some suggestions:
- Extra Toppings: Consider adding toppings such as pepperoni, sausage, mushrooms, onions, or bell peppers.
- Cheese Blend: Try different cheese blends like mozzarella, cheddar, parmesan, or feta for a unique twist.
- Herbs and Seasonings: Sprinkle dried herbs like oregano, basil, or thyme over the pizza before cooking for an extra burst of flavour. You can also add crushed red pepper flakes for some spice.
- Sauces and Drizzles: Experiment with drizzling barbecue sauce, buffalo sauce, pesto, or garlic-infused olive oil over the pizza for a creative touch.
- Fresh Ingredients: Add fresh basil leaves, cherry tomatoes, arugula, or spinach after cooking for a pop of colour and freshness.
After adding your desired toppings, it's important to arrange the pizza slices carefully in the air fryer basket. Place them in a single layer, ensuring they don't overlap, as this will allow them to cook evenly. Now, you're ready to cook your Ellio's pizza slices in the air fryer!

Cook for 5-7 minutes
Place the Ellio's pizza in the air fryer and set the timer for 5-7 minutes. This cooking time is ideal for getting that crispy, golden texture and melting the cheese through. It's important not to wander too far from the kitchen during this time, as you don't want your pizza to burn.
Keep a close eye on the pizza, especially if this is your first time cooking Ellio's in an air fryer. You want to aim for an even, light browning across the pizza. If you're cooking multiple pizzas, you may need to adjust the time and temperature slightly to ensure even cooking.
During the cooking process, the air fryer rapidly heats the pizza, crisping the base and cooking the toppings. The hot air circulates around the food, creating a crispy texture. This method of cooking is faster and healthier than traditional frying, as less oil is required.
After 5-7 minutes, your Ellio's pizza should be cooked to perfection. Remove it from the air fryer and let it cool slightly before serving. Enjoy the delicious, crispy treat!
